titleOfInvention Ceramic metal halide lamp
abstract A metal halide lamp by which both a high color rendering index (Ra≥80) and a high efficiency [η≥100 (lm/W)], which are contrary to each other, can be achieved. The metal halide lamp is provided with a light-emitting tube (1) comprising a translucent ceramic, wherein: capillaries (3A, 3B) are continuously formed, mediated by a transition curved surface (4) free from angled corner, in both terminal sides along the major axial direction of a light-emitting part (2) which is in a roughly ellipsoidal shape; the ratio (L/D) of the efficient length (L) to the efficient inner diameter (D) is set to 1.8-2.2; the inside dimension is determined so that, while the lamp is lighting, the lowest temperature in the light-emitting part is 800
